  • Patent number: 5494811
    Abstract: A fluidized bed reactor system which utilizes a fluid phase, a retained fluidized primary particulate phase, and a migratory second particulate phase. The primary particulate phase is a particle such as a gel bead containing an immobilized biocatalyst. The secondary and tertiary particulate phases, continuously introduced and removed simultaneously in the cocurrent and countercurrent mode, act in a role such as a sorbent to continuously remove a product or by-product constituent from the fluid phase. Means for introducing and removing the sorbent phases include feed screw mechanisms and multivane slurry valves.

  • Patent number: 5409822
    Abstract: A fluidized bed reactor system utilizes a fluid phase, a retained fluidized primary particulate phase, and a migratory second particulate phase. The primary particulate phase is a particle such as a gel bead containing an immobilized biocatalyst. The secondary particulate phase, continuously introduced and removed in either cocurrent or countercurrent mode, acts in a secondary role such as a sorbent to continuously remove a product or by-product constituent from the fluid phase. Introduction and removal of the sorbent phase is accomplished through the use of feed screw mechanisms and multivane slurry valves.

  • Patent number: 4982945
    Abstract: For a copier with a document handler ejecting original documents after copying into a document collection tray system, a plural mode document collecting system is provided for collecting and restacking different forms of documents, including both conventional sheet documents and computer form web being re-fanfolded, with a single tray movable between two different operative tray mounting positions in a substantially vertical track, with respective retentions at a first tray position adjacent the document output of the document handler for collecting conventional sheet documents, and a second tray position substantially below the first tray position for re-fanfolding computer form web. Also disclosed are stationary fanfold restacking assist members operative in the second tray position mounted intermediately of the first and second tray mounting positions and mutually adapted with the tray to allow the tray to be moved past.
